XYC283261 View from Snowdon from Sands of Traeth Mawe, taken at the Ford between Pont Aberglaslyn and Tremadoc, 1834 (w/c & gouache over graphite on paper) by Fielding, Anthony Vandyke Copley (1787-1855); 64.8x92.1 cm; Yale Center for British Art, Paul Mellon Collection, USA; English, out of copyright

View from Snowdon from Sands of Traeth Mawe captures the breathtaking beauty of the Welsh landscape, showcasing the majestic Snowdonia mountains in all their glory. Painted by Anthony Vandyke Copley Fielding in 1834, this stunning artwork transports us to a time when nature reigned supreme. In this scene, we witness a typical day in rural Wales as rain gently falls upon the rugged terrain. A group of farmers and travelers navigate their way across a ford between Pont Aberglaslyn and Tremadoc, accompanied by their trusty horses. The herd of cattle peacefully grazes nearby, undisturbed by the weather. The artist's meticulous attention to detail is evident in every brushstroke. From the rocky pools reflecting the cloudy sky to the shimmering river cutting through the land, each element adds depth and realism to this romanticized depiction.
